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.
Aggiungere e rimuovere tag per EC2 le risorse Amazon
Quando crei una EC2 risorsa Amazon, ad esempio un'EC2istanza Amazon, puoi specificare i tag da aggiungere alla risorsa. Puoi anche utilizzare la EC2 console Amazon per visualizzare i tag per una EC2 risorsa Amazon specifica. Puoi anche aggiungere o rimuovere tag da una EC2 risorsa Amazon esistente.
Puoi utilizzare il Tag Editor nella AWS Resource Groups console per visualizzare, aggiungere o rimuovere tag da tutte le tue AWS risorse in tutte le regioni. Puoi applicare o rimuovere tag da più tipi di risorse contemporaneamente. Per ulteriori informazioni, consulta la Tagging AWS Resources User Guide.
Attività
Aggiungi e rimuovi tag utilizzando la console
Puoi gestire i tag per una risorsa esistente direttamente dalla pagina della risorsa.
Per gestire i tag per una risorsa esistente
Apri la EC2 console Amazon all'indirizzo https://console.aws.amazon.com/ec2/
. -
Dalla barra di navigazione, seleziona la regione in cui si trova la risorsa.
-
Nel riquadro di navigazione selezionare un tipo di risorsa, ad esempio Instances (Istanze).
-
Seleziona la risorsa dall'elenco.
-
Dalla scheda Tag, scegli Gestisci tag.
-
Per aggiungere un tag, scegli Aggiungi nuovo tag e inserisci una chiave e un valore per il tag. Per rimuovere un tag, scegli Remove (Rimuovi).
-
Seleziona Salva.
Aggiungi tag utilizzando il AWS CLI
Negli esempi seguenti viene illustrato come aggiungere tag a una risorsa esistente utilizzando il comando create-tags.
Esempio: aggiunta di un tag a una risorsa
Il comando seguente aggiunge il tag Stack=production
all'immagine specificata o sovrascrive un tag esistente per la chiave AMI where the tag. Stack
Se il comando va a buon fine, non viene restituito alcun output.
aws ec2 create-tags \ --resources ami-78a54011 \ --tags Key=
Stack
,Value=production
Esempio: aggiunta di tag a più risorse.
Questo esempio aggiunge (o sovrascrive) due tag per un'istanza AMI e un'istanza. Uno dei tag contiene solo una chiave (webserver
), senza alcun valore (il valore viene impostato su una stringa vuota). L'altro tag comprende una chiave (stack
) e un valore (Production
). Se il comando va a buon fine, non viene restituito alcun output.
aws ec2 create-tags \ --resources ami-1a2b3c4d i-1234567890abcdef0 \ --tags Key=
webserver
,Value= Key=stack
,Value=Production
Esempio: aggiunta di tag con caratteri speciali
Questo esempio aggiunge il tag [Group]=test
a un'istanza. Le parentesi quadre ([
e ]
) sono caratteri speciali, per i quali occorre eseguire l'escape.
Se si utilizza Linux o OS X, per eseguire l'escape dei caratteri speciali, racchiudere l'elemento con il carattere speciale tra virgolette doppie ("
), quindi racchiudere l'intera struttura chiave e valore tra virgolette singole ('
).
aws ec2 create-tags \ --resources i-1234567890abcdef0 \ --tags 'Key="
[Group]
",Value=test
'
Se si utilizza Windows, per eseguire l'escape dei caratteri speciali, racchiudere l'elemento con caratteri speciali tra virgolette doppie ("), quindi anteporre ad ogni carattere virgolette doppie una barra rovesciata (\
) come segue:
aws ec2 create-tags ^ --resources i-1234567890abcdef0 ^ --tags Key=\"
[Group]
\",Value=test
Se utilizzate Windows PowerShell, per evitare i caratteri speciali, racchiudete il valore contenente caratteri speciali tra virgolette doppie ("
), fate precedere ogni virgoletta doppia da una barra rovesciata (\
), quindi racchiudete l'intera chiave e la struttura dei valori tra virgolette singole () come segue: '
aws ec2 create-tags ` --resources i-1234567890abcdef0 ` --tags 'Key=\"
[Group]
\",Value=test
'
Aggiungi tag usando CloudFormation
Con i tipi di EC2 risorse Amazon, specifichi i tag utilizzando una TagSpecifications
proprietà Tags
o.
I seguenti esempi aggiungono il tag Stack=Production
a AWS::EC2: :Instance utilizzando la sua Tags
proprietà.
Esempio: tag in YAML
Tags: - Key: "Stack" Value: "Production"
Esempio: tag in JSON
"Tags": [ { "Key": "Stack", "Value": "Production" } ]
Gli esempi seguenti aggiungono il tag Stack=Production
a AWS::EC2:: LaunchTemplate LaunchTemplateData utilizzando la sua TagSpecifications
proprietà.
Esempio: TagSpecifications in YAML
TagSpecifications: - ResourceType: "instance" Tags: - Key: "Stack" Value: "Production"
Esempio: TagSpecifications in JSON
"TagSpecifications": [ { "ResourceType": "instance", "Tags": [ { "Key": "Stack", "Value": "Production" } ] } ]